The A1C test measures your average blood sugar levels over the past 2-3 months. It is typically performed in a lab or doctor's office, and you cannot calculate it at home. However, you can estimate your A1C using your average blood glucose levels with the following formula:
A1C (%) = (Average Blood Glucose (mg/dL) + 46.7) / 28.7
For example, if your average blood glucose is 154 mg/dL:
A1C = (154 + 46.7) / 28.7 ≈ 7.0%
Here’s a quick reference table:
126 6.0
154 7.0
183 8.0
212 9.0
240 10.0
Note: This is an estimation. For an accurate A1C reading, consult your healthcare provider and get a lab test.
